|
@@ -506,6 +506,18 @@ public class TeacherServiceImpl extends ServiceImpl<TeacherDao, Teacher> impleme
|
|
|
} else {
|
|
|
teacherHomeVo.setLiveing(YesOrNoEnum.NO);
|
|
|
}
|
|
|
+
|
|
|
+ //针对录屏用户30483特殊处理
|
|
|
+ if(30483 == userId.longValue()) {
|
|
|
+ teacherHomeVo.setBrowse(teacherHomeVo.getBrowse() + 38000);
|
|
|
+ teacherHomeVo.setFansNum(teacherHomeVo.getFansNum() + 6500);
|
|
|
+ teacherHomeVo.setMusicAlbumNum(teacherHomeVo.getMusicAlbumNum() + 8);
|
|
|
+ teacherHomeVo.setMusicSheetNum(teacherHomeVo.getMusicSheetNum() + 200);
|
|
|
+ teacherHomeVo.setStudentNums(teacherHomeVo.getStudentNums() + 25);
|
|
|
+ teacherHomeVo.setExpTime(teacherHomeVo.getExpTime() + 125);
|
|
|
+ teacherHomeVo.setUnExpTime(teacherHomeVo.getUnExpTime() + 80);
|
|
|
+ }
|
|
|
+
|
|
|
return HttpResponseResult.succeed(teacherHomeVo);
|
|
|
}
|
|
|
|
|
@@ -1469,34 +1481,38 @@ public class TeacherServiceImpl extends ServiceImpl<TeacherDao, Teacher> impleme
|
|
|
|
|
|
if (teacherId != null) {
|
|
|
Teacher teacher = getById(teacherId);
|
|
|
- if (teacher.getIsSettlement() !=null && !teacher.getIsSettlement()) {
|
|
|
- accountTenantTo.setIncomeTenant(0L);
|
|
|
- } else if (teacher.getTenantId() != null && teacher.getTenantId() > 0) {
|
|
|
- accountTenantTo.setIncomeTenant(teacher.getTenantId());
|
|
|
- if (ESettlementFrom.TEACHER.equals(teacher.getSettlementFrom())) {
|
|
|
+ if(teacher != null) {
|
|
|
+ if (teacher.getIsSettlement() !=null && !teacher.getIsSettlement()) {
|
|
|
+ accountTenantTo.setIncomeTenant(0L);
|
|
|
+ } else if (teacher.getTenantId() != null && teacher.getTenantId() > 0) {
|
|
|
+ accountTenantTo.setIncomeTenant(teacher.getTenantId());
|
|
|
+ if (ESettlementFrom.TEACHER.equals(teacher.getSettlementFrom())) {
|
|
|
+ accountTenantTo.setIncomeTeacher(true);
|
|
|
+ }
|
|
|
+ } else {
|
|
|
+ // 分润给老师
|
|
|
+ accountTenantTo.setIncomeTenant(-1L);
|
|
|
accountTenantTo.setIncomeTeacher(true);
|
|
|
}
|
|
|
- } else {
|
|
|
- // 分润给老师
|
|
|
- accountTenantTo.setIncomeTenant(-1L);
|
|
|
- accountTenantTo.setIncomeTeacher(true);
|
|
|
}
|
|
|
}
|
|
|
|
|
|
|
|
|
if (recomUserId != null) {
|
|
|
Teacher teacher = getById(recomUserId);
|
|
|
- if (teacher.getIsSettlement() !=null && !teacher.getIsSettlement()) {
|
|
|
- accountTenantTo.setShareTenant(0L);
|
|
|
- } else if (teacher.getTenantId() != null && teacher.getTenantId() > 0) {
|
|
|
- accountTenantTo.setShareTenant(teacher.getTenantId());
|
|
|
- if (ESettlementFrom.TEACHER.equals(teacher.getSettlementFrom())) {
|
|
|
+ if(teacher != null) {
|
|
|
+ if (teacher.getIsSettlement() !=null && !teacher.getIsSettlement()) {
|
|
|
+ accountTenantTo.setShareTenant(0L);
|
|
|
+ } else if (teacher.getTenantId() != null && teacher.getTenantId() > 0) {
|
|
|
+ accountTenantTo.setShareTenant(teacher.getTenantId());
|
|
|
+ if (ESettlementFrom.TEACHER.equals(teacher.getSettlementFrom())) {
|
|
|
+ accountTenantTo.setShareTeacher(true);
|
|
|
+ }
|
|
|
+ } else {
|
|
|
+ // 分润给老师
|
|
|
+ accountTenantTo.setShareTenant(-1L);
|
|
|
accountTenantTo.setShareTeacher(true);
|
|
|
}
|
|
|
- } else {
|
|
|
- // 分润给老师
|
|
|
- accountTenantTo.setShareTenant(-1L);
|
|
|
- accountTenantTo.setShareTeacher(true);
|
|
|
}
|
|
|
}
|
|
|
|